Man Falsely Confesses to Charlie Kirk's Killing, Faces 15-Year Sentence and Child Sex Charges

George Zinn, a 71-year-old man from Provo, Utah, made headlines when he falsely confessed to the shooting death of Charlie Kirk. On 30th January 2026, Zinn faced the consequences of his actions during a court hearing. He pleaded no contest to the false confession allegation, which could result in a sentence of up to 15 years in prison. During the same hearing, he admitted to possessing child sexual abuse material, leading to additional charges and potential penalties.

US Department of Justice Launches Civil Rights Investigation into Fatal Shooting of Minneapolis Nurse Alex Pretti

The US Department of Justice (DoJ) has launched a federal civil rights investigation into the fatal shooting of Minneapolis nurse Alex Pretti by immigration officers. Pretti, 37, was shot dead on January 30, 2026, after a verbal altercation with immigration officers outside a local bar. The news of the investigation comes as protests in Minneapolis continue to intensify.

Justice Department Releases Over 3 Million Pages of New Epstein Investigation Documents

The documents stem from the Labor Department's investigation into Epstein's recruitment of workers for his Palm Beach mansion between 2000 and 2005. The documents are set to be released in batches, with the first batch totaling over 3 million pages. The final release is anticipated to take several months. The release follows the high-profile investigation and subsequent death of Jeffrey Epstein in August 2019.
